WebUp to 50 weeks' leave and 37 weeks' pay can be shared between parents if the mother brings her maternity leave and pay to an end early. SPL can be taken by one parent or taken together. The mother can take SPL after she has taken the legally required two weeks of maternity leave immediately following the birth of the child. WebThe partner can take shared parental leave at any time following the birth or placement of a child for adoption, up to the first year of birth/placement.
